How do you evaluate (4ab)/(8c), where a=8, b=4, and c=1/2?

32

Explanation:

To solve this expression, we plug in the numbers it has given us in the problem, and then simply solve.

So because of the information given, we rewrite the expression as:

(4ab)/(8c) => (4(8)(4))/(8(1/2))

Now we can solve the expression:

(4(8)(4))/(8(1/2)) => ((32)(4))/(4) => 128/4 => 32
